SCAP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review

4 of the 4,539 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AdvisorShares Cornerstone Small Cap ETF (SCAP)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$2.21M — down 41% from $3.75M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 1 fund closed out of SCAP and 0 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 1 trimmed existing stakes and 1 added.

The largest buyer was UBS Group, adding an estimated $15.1K. The largest seller was Cornerstone Investment Partners, cutting an estimated $289K.
